    I can't take prescription migraine pills, because they all are from the same "family" that have an increased chance of stroke. Since I've had a stroke (in the right eye), doc won't write anymore prescriptions for them.
    Which is too bad, because they used to work.

    So, I started taking Excedrin migraine, but they don't work very well for me. So I used to take A LOT. Which burned a hole in the stomach, into a vein, and I almost bled to death.

    Sooo... I guess I'm F'd and have to deal with them.



    I do get the botox migraine treatment. It cuts down on the amount, and USUALLY the severity. But some bad ones slip through.
